ПОИСК
Быстрый заказ
ОЦЕНКА КУРСАобщая оценка курса:оценка преподавателя: Хочу скидку |
Управление требованиями – важная часть разработки ПО. Очевидна цена ошибки в случае неверной постановки задачи. Курс обучает разработке качественных требований на всех этапах: выявление, разработка, проверка, утверждение требований, моделирование предметной области и анализ требований, управление изменениями требований.
Рекомендации курса основаны на проектном опыте применения свода практик бизнес-анализа BABOK v3 (Business Analysis Body of Knowledge), разработанного International Institute of Business Analysis. Моделирование прецедентов использования и предметной области проводится с использованием унифицированного языка моделирования (Unified Modeling Language, UML 2.0). Рассматриваются вопросы использования серий государственных стандартов ГОСТ 34 и ГОСТ 19. В управлении требованиями есть специфика, связанная с человеческим фактором и динамикой изменений. На курсе рассматриваются возможные трудности и способы их преодоления. В современных условиях управление требованиями нуждается в балансе хорошей структуры-методологии и гибкости взаимодействия участников процесса. Курс помогает сформировать методологическую платформу и научиться на практике встраивать ее в процесс разработки ПО. Это дистанционный авторский курс, при котором всё его время (16 учебных часов) тренер «вживую» работает с онлайн-аудиторией: делится опытом, на примерах объясняет учебный материал, отвечает на вопросы, в ходе упражнений проверяет прогресс в понимании изученного материала и выявляет пробелы для их заполнения.
Выберите форму обучения,
чтобы увидеть актуальные даты:
РАСПИСАНИЕ ЗАНЯТИЙ
|
После изучения курса вы сможете
По завершении обучения участники приобретают компетенции в следующих областях:
- выявление и анализ требований
- управление требованиями
- управление изменениями требований
- моделирование предметной области
- выстраивание бизнес-анализа в различных типах жизненного цикла разработки
Содержание курса
1. Выявление и анализ требований
- Что такое «требование»
- Типы требований
- Выявление бизнес-требований и бизнес-правил
- Выявление ожиданий заинтересованных лиц
- Выявление пользовательских требований
- Выявление требований к пользовательскому интерфейсу
- Определение границ системы
- Выявление функциональных требований
- Выявление нефункциональных требований
- Упражнение 1. Определение типа требований
- Модель прецедентов использования
- Упражнение 2. Разработка диаграммы прецедентов и описания прецедентов
- Модель предметной области
- Упражнение 3. Разработка модели предметной области методом «Существительное / глагол»
- Процесс разработки и анализа требований
- План управления требованиями
- Атрибуты требований
- Управление состояниями требований
- Приоритезация требований
- Упражнение 4. Разработка модели приоритезации требований
- Спецификации требований
- Принципы тестирования требований
- Согласование и утверждение требований
- Управление изменениями требований
- Водопадный жизненный цикл разработки
- Итеративный жизненный цикл разработки
- Быстрые методы разработки (Agile)
Слушатели
- бизнес-аналитики
- системные аналитики
- разработчики, тестировщики и ИТ-специалисты
- руководители ИТ-подразделений
- руководители проектов
- консультанты
Предварительная подготовка
Участники должны обладать опытом работы на руководящих позициях или позициях аналитиков, проектировщиков информационных систем.